【文章內(nèi)容簡(jiǎn)介】
鍵、圖標(biāo)等。現(xiàn)舉例如下: ● 企業(yè)員工培訓(xùn)管理系統(tǒng)開始界面設(shè)計(jì) 該模塊的主要功能是當(dāng)用戶啟動(dòng)使用員工培訓(xùn)管理系統(tǒng)時(shí),顯示一個(gè)友好歡迎界面如圖 54 所示。開始界面上的歡迎詞每隔 1 秒閃爍一次。當(dāng)用戶按下鍵盤任一按建時(shí),系統(tǒng)自動(dòng)進(jìn)入下一級(jí)表單。 圖 54 開始界面 ● 系統(tǒng)退出界面 該模塊的設(shè)計(jì)目的是當(dāng)用戶退出系統(tǒng)時(shí)顯示感謝詞,畫面停留兩秒后 自動(dòng)退出。 學(xué)士學(xué)位論文 員工培訓(xùn)管理系統(tǒng)開發(fā)設(shè)計(jì) 22 圖 55 系統(tǒng)退出界面 本模塊主要是為用戶提供一個(gè)功能選擇界面,根據(jù)用戶所需的不同選擇,打開不同的下級(jí)菜單并提供相應(yīng)的功能服務(wù)。本模塊利用一個(gè)表單可以實(shí)現(xiàn)其功能。 下面將 功能選擇界面設(shè)計(jì)為例 詳細(xì)介紹本模塊的設(shè)計(jì)。首先新建一個(gè)表單Form1,將其保存為“ main menu”,選擇路徑。在表單上添加 1個(gè)“ Option group”控件、 1個(gè)“ Image”控件和 2 個(gè)“ Command”控件,各控件的主要屬性見表 52。 控件名稱 屬性名稱 屬性值 Forml Caption 功能選擇界面 Deskeop . Height 263 left 84 Forml Top 92 Width 256 Optiongroupl Buttoncount 8 Height 192 Left 12 Top 24 Width 336 Value 1 Optiongroupl 中的 Option1 Caption 培訓(xùn)需求管理 Optiongroupl 中的 Option2 Caption 培訓(xùn)計(jì)劃管理 Optiongroupl 中的 Option3 Caption 基本信息管理 Optiongroupl 中的 Option4 Caption 培訓(xùn)效果評(píng)價(jià) 學(xué)士學(xué)位論文 員工培訓(xùn)管理系統(tǒng)開發(fā)設(shè)計(jì) 23 Optiongroupl 中的 Option5 Caption 培訓(xùn)計(jì)劃實(shí)施 Optiongroupl 中的 Option6 Caption 培訓(xùn)資源管理 Optiongroupl 中的 Option7 Caption 系統(tǒng)管理 Optiongroupl 中的 Option8 Caption 其他 Command1 Caption 確定 Command2 Caption 退出 Image1 Stretch 3_stretch Picture .\ 下面為表中各事件添加代碼。在“確定”按鈕的“ Click”事件中添加代碼如下: do case case =1 do form .\form\pxjhg1 case =1 do form .\form\jbxxg1 case =1 do form .\form\pxxqgpj case =1 do form .x\form\pxzyg1 case =1 do form .\form\xtg1 dcase *根據(jù)用戶的不同選擇打開不同的下級(jí)表單 在“退出”按鈕的“ Click”事件中添加代碼如下“ do form .\form\end *執(zhí)行退出界面表單,同時(shí) 釋放本表單 將該表單保存后這一模塊就建好了。功能選擇模塊的設(shè)計(jì)結(jié)果如圖 56 所示 學(xué)士學(xué)位論文 員工培訓(xùn)管理系統(tǒng)開發(fā)設(shè)計(jì) 24 圖 56 功能選擇界面 其它模塊功能簡(jiǎn)述 培訓(xùn)計(jì)劃模塊的內(nèi)容主要包括培訓(xùn)計(jì)劃制作、學(xué)員管理、培訓(xùn)成本管理、任務(wù)檢查列表。(如下圖) ● 培訓(xùn)計(jì)劃制作 該程序主要根據(jù)報(bào)名培訓(xùn)的員工、安排的培訓(xùn)內(nèi)容、計(jì)劃培訓(xùn)的時(shí)間、地點(diǎn)、教員、合作的培訓(xùn)中介情況來(lái)制作培訓(xùn)計(jì)劃。 ● 培訓(xùn)成本 根據(jù)課本資料、設(shè)備設(shè)施、培訓(xùn)教員的工資、場(chǎng)地租金、提供服務(wù)的費(fèi)用來(lái)計(jì)算當(dāng)期培訓(xùn)的總費(fèi)用及人均費(fèi)用,并對(duì)這些費(fèi)用進(jìn)行錄入、編輯 、查詢、打印輸出。 學(xué)士學(xué)位論文 員工培訓(xùn)管理系統(tǒng)開發(fā)設(shè)計(jì) 25 ● 任務(wù)檢查列表 本模塊主要負(fù)責(zé)提醒下一步要完成的培訓(xùn)任務(wù),顯示要提供的服務(wù)項(xiàng)目完成進(jìn)度情況。 基礎(chǔ)信息管理 其中包括 1。課程信息管理、 2。學(xué)員管理、 3。成績(jī)管理(如下圖) 1. 課程信息管理 本模塊主要提供課程信息情況,內(nèi)容包括單課信息、組課信息、培訓(xùn)內(nèi)容類別 ● 單課信息 根據(jù)企業(yè)員工培訓(xùn)提供的單門課程的信息進(jìn)行錄入、編輯、查詢、報(bào)表打印操作。 ● 組課信息 根據(jù)企業(yè)員工培訓(xùn)提供的組合課程的信息進(jìn)行錄入、編輯、查詢、報(bào)表打印操作。 ● 培訓(xùn)內(nèi)容類別 對(duì)提供的培訓(xùn)類別 信息進(jìn)行錄入、編輯、查詢處理。 2. 學(xué)員管理 它主要完成對(duì)當(dāng)期注冊(cè)學(xué)員信息錄入、編輯、查詢、打印工作 3.成績(jī)管理 該模塊分為考試和技能認(rèn)證兩部分內(nèi)容。根據(jù)考試成績(jī)確定該員工是否能獲得認(rèn)證。 學(xué)士學(xué)位論文 員工培訓(xùn)管理系統(tǒng)開發(fā)設(shè)計(jì) 26 ● 考試管理 主要完成對(duì)學(xué)員的考試成績(jī)的錄入、編輯、查詢、打印輸出處理。 ● 技能認(rèn)證 主要完成對(duì)認(rèn)證書信息和證書發(fā)放信息的錄入、編輯、查詢、打印的操作。 培訓(xùn)管理評(píng)估根據(jù)該期培訓(xùn)的教學(xué)質(zhì)量、管理情況的各項(xiàng)指標(biāo)進(jìn)行評(píng)估,最后得出該期的總體情況評(píng)估。主要內(nèi)容包括學(xué)員考勤、培訓(xùn)教師評(píng)估、培 訓(xùn)管理質(zhì)量評(píng)估、培訓(xùn)總體評(píng)估。 (如下圖 ) ● 學(xué)員考勤 主要負(fù)責(zé)對(duì)學(xué)員出勤情況的錄入、編輯、查詢、報(bào)表打印的操作。 ●培訓(xùn)教師評(píng)估 根據(jù)對(duì)培訓(xùn)教師的出勤情況、教學(xué)質(zhì)量、教學(xué)態(tài)度、教學(xué)方法的評(píng)分,給出對(duì)培訓(xùn)教師的總的評(píng)估。該模塊就是負(fù)責(zé)對(duì)這些數(shù)據(jù)的錄入、編輯、查詢、報(bào)表打印。 ● 培訓(xùn)管理質(zhì)量評(píng)估 根據(jù)該期培訓(xùn)的配套服務(wù)的好壞、設(shè)備設(shè)施的質(zhì)量、培訓(xùn)教材資料的好壞、培訓(xùn)紀(jì)律的好壞、培訓(xùn)環(huán)境的好壞 來(lái)評(píng)定整個(gè)培訓(xùn)的管理質(zhì)量水平。然后根據(jù)這些信息匯總成總表,以備查詢、打印輸出。 ● 總評(píng)估 根據(jù)以上各項(xiàng)評(píng)估結(jié)果 ,匯總對(duì)該期的總的評(píng)估。該模塊主要對(duì)這些信息進(jìn)行顯示、打印輸出處理 / 學(xué)士學(xué)位論文 員工培訓(xùn)管理系統(tǒng)開發(fā)設(shè)計(jì) 27 該部分主要提供一些相關(guān)信息以備查詢。這些信息主要有企業(yè)部門設(shè)置情況、部門職位設(shè)置情況、培訓(xùn)中介單位的信息、教材采購(gòu)庫(kù)存信息、設(shè)備設(shè)施管理信息、其他參考信息。 這一個(gè)模塊主要完成對(duì)用戶、用戶權(quán)限以及數(shù)據(jù)安全、數(shù)據(jù)備份、數(shù)據(jù)恢復(fù)的功能和確定該用戶是否是合法用戶,根據(jù)權(quán)限合法用戶又分系統(tǒng)負(fù)責(zé)人各一般用戶。一般用戶可以修改自己的密碼,而系統(tǒng)負(fù)責(zé)人還可以進(jìn)行增刪用戶的操作。(如下圖) 的特點(diǎn)、 存在的問(wèn)題及今后的發(fā)展方向 系統(tǒng)設(shè)計(jì)的特點(diǎn) ( 1)用戶界面使用友好。既可以用鼠標(biāo),也可以用鍵盤完成整個(gè)操作。 ( 2)本系統(tǒng)不僅實(shí)現(xiàn)了對(duì)企業(yè)員工培訓(xùn)整個(gè)流程的管理功能,而且使企業(yè)的培訓(xùn)工作系統(tǒng)化、規(guī)范化、自動(dòng)化,從而達(dá)到提高企業(yè)培訓(xùn)管理效率的目的。 ( 3)系統(tǒng)實(shí)現(xiàn)了一定程度的通用性。不同的企業(yè)都可以根據(jù)自己的需要稍加修改,就可應(yīng)用。 ( 4)系統(tǒng)采用開發(fā)式的模塊架構(gòu),便于系統(tǒng)升級(jí)、擴(kuò)充和用戶自行再開發(fā)。 學(xué)士學(xué)位論文 員工培訓(xùn)管理系統(tǒng)開發(fā)設(shè)計(jì) 28 系統(tǒng)存在的問(wèn)題及今后的發(fā)展方向 由于時(shí)間和其他等方面的條件限制,本系統(tǒng)再開發(fā)中存在以下問(wèn)題: ① 系 統(tǒng)有些附帶的功能尚未實(shí)現(xiàn)。 ② 由于開發(fā)環(huán)境的限制,系統(tǒng)還只能單機(jī)上運(yùn)行。要同其它計(jì)算機(jī)通信必須通過(guò)電子郵件的方式來(lái)實(shí)現(xiàn)。 根據(jù)上述內(nèi)容,可以知道系統(tǒng)今后的發(fā)展,首先就是要實(shí)現(xiàn)以上功能。但除此以外,開發(fā)要從以下幾個(gè)方面考慮,以便能滿足用戶發(fā)展的需要和計(jì)算機(jī)硬件的升級(jí)的需求。 系統(tǒng)將從現(xiàn)在的 C/S 模式轉(zhuǎn)化為 B/S 模式,以適應(yīng)企業(yè)員工培訓(xùn)采用多媒體教學(xué)。 系統(tǒng) 版本應(yīng)由現(xiàn)在的單機(jī)版升級(jí)為網(wǎng)絡(luò)版,以利于與企業(yè) Intra 及 Inter 交互通訊。 ① 數(shù)據(jù)數(shù)據(jù)庫(kù)結(jié)構(gòu)要由現(xiàn)在的但層模式,發(fā)展為以后的多層體系結(jié)構(gòu),以適 應(yīng)企業(yè)規(guī)模的擴(kuò)展需求。這樣就可以將數(shù)據(jù)計(jì)算任務(wù)集中在能力較強(qiáng)的計(jì)算機(jī)上,從而減輕計(jì)算能力較差的客戶機(jī)的負(fù)擔(dān),具體所明如下: ② 一個(gè)數(shù)據(jù)庫(kù)應(yīng)用程序在邏輯上通常由兩個(gè)部分組成,一是數(shù)據(jù)訪問(wèn)鏈路,二是用戶界面,這二者的組合既是應(yīng)用程序的本系結(jié)構(gòu)。 單層模式是數(shù)據(jù)庫(kù)應(yīng)用程序與數(shù)據(jù)庫(kù)共享同意個(gè)文件系統(tǒng),使用的是本地?cái)?shù)據(jù)庫(kù)或文件來(lái)存取數(shù)據(jù)。此時(shí)用戶界面與數(shù)據(jù)訪問(wèn)鏈路是統(tǒng)一的,這樣不僅增加了本機(jī)的負(fù)擔(dān),而且設(shè)計(jì)界面難以保持一致的風(fēng)格。 ③ 兩層數(shù)據(jù)庫(kù)應(yīng)用程序是客戶程序提供用戶界面,通過(guò) BDE 從遠(yuǎn)程數(shù)據(jù)服務(wù)器獲取數(shù)據(jù)。 在這種體系結(jié)構(gòu)中,數(shù)據(jù)庫(kù)訪問(wèn)鏈路設(shè)計(jì)與用戶界面設(shè)計(jì)就分開了,從而能達(dá)到比較好的設(shè)計(jì)效果。 ④ 多層數(shù)據(jù)庫(kù)應(yīng)用程序中,客戶程序、應(yīng)用服務(wù)器和遠(yuǎn)程服務(wù)器分布在不同機(jī)器上。其中,客戶程序主要提供用戶界面它能夠向應(yīng)用服務(wù)器請(qǐng)求數(shù)據(jù)和申請(qǐng)更新數(shù)據(jù),再由應(yīng)用服務(wù)器向數(shù)據(jù)庫(kù)服務(wù)器請(qǐng)求數(shù)據(jù)和申請(qǐng)更新數(shù)據(jù)。正因?yàn)樵擉w系結(jié)構(gòu)具有以上特點(diǎn),今年來(lái),多層分布式數(shù)據(jù)應(yīng)用系統(tǒng)體系結(jié)構(gòu)得到了越來(lái)越廣泛應(yīng)用。學(xué)士學(xué)位論文 員工培訓(xùn)管理系統(tǒng)開發(fā)設(shè)計(jì) 29 結(jié)束語(yǔ) 本文分析了員工培訓(xùn)管理系統(tǒng)并對(duì)這一個(gè)管理系統(tǒng)做了具體的設(shè)計(jì),對(duì)系統(tǒng)進(jìn)行了實(shí)地調(diào)研分析和軟件開發(fā)分析。 由于本系統(tǒng)是基于 Visual FoxPro 開發(fā)而成的,采用 VF 自己的數(shù)據(jù)庫(kù)所以開發(fā)和維護(hù)都很簡(jiǎn)單。系統(tǒng)操作也非常簡(jiǎn)單易懂,容易上手。但由于時(shí)間倉(cāng)促還有很多功能沒(méi)有完善,系統(tǒng)只能單機(jī)上運(yùn)行,擁有一定的局限性。這些缺點(diǎn)有待于以后逐步完善。除此之外,還要注意用戶對(duì)系統(tǒng)要求的升級(jí),和硬件的升級(jí)來(lái)考慮軟件的完善。通過(guò)介紹以達(dá)到觸類旁通,舉一反三的目的,也可以對(duì)企業(yè)員工管理系統(tǒng)有進(jìn)一步的了解和認(rèn)識(shí)。學(xué)士學(xué)位論文 員工培訓(xùn)管理系統(tǒng)開發(fā)設(shè)計(jì) 30 致 謝 值此本文即將完成之際,謹(jǐn)向所有關(guān)心我的老師,同學(xué),親人們致以真摯的感謝。 首先感謝指導(dǎo)教師周修理老師的關(guān)心,姜指導(dǎo)和教誨。 本人在做畢業(yè)設(shè)計(jì)期間自始至終都是在老師全面、具體、耐心的指導(dǎo)下進(jìn)行的。周老師對(duì)我們的論文質(zhì)量嚴(yán)格要求 ,十分令人尊敬。 感謝我的老師們,在我學(xué)習(xí)中,不僅教會(huì)我專業(yè)性的理論知識(shí),還教會(huì)我如何自學(xué),在本次設(shè)計(jì)中,老師們教會(huì)我的東西,讓我更好的發(fā)揮了我的專業(yè)水平及我的自學(xué)能力。在此我對(duì)我所有的老師表示深深的謝意。 另外,感謝我的同事和朋友,在我設(shè)計(jì)期間他們對(duì)我的不斷的支持和鼓勵(lì)是我前進(jìn)的動(dòng)力源泉。在論文設(shè)計(jì)過(guò)程中,他 (她 )們?yōu)槲姨峁┝舜罅康馁Y料和建議。使我能順利完成整個(gè)過(guò)程。 最后,再次向所有關(guān)心、幫助、理解、支持 我的老師和同學(xué)們致以深深的謝意。感謝他們對(duì)我的無(wú)私幫助!學(xué)士學(xué)位論文 員工培訓(xùn)管理系統(tǒng)開發(fā)設(shè)計(jì) 31 參考文獻(xiàn) [1] 崔寶深,王娟 Visual FoxPro 程序設(shè)計(jì)教程 南開大學(xué)出版社 ( 1): 263~299 [2]邵洋,谷宇,何旭洪 Visual FoxPro 數(shù)據(jù)庫(kù)系統(tǒng)開發(fā)實(shí)例導(dǎo)航 人民郵電出版社 [3]李凡 Visual FoxPro 程序設(shè)計(jì)基礎(chǔ)教程 水利水電出版社 [4]蔡偉,劉立志 段海午 范有元 Visual FoxPro 應(yīng)用開發(fā)實(shí)例 人民郵電出版社 [5]余文芳 Visual FoxPro 人民郵電出版社 [6]范立南,張宇 Visual FoxPro 程序設(shè)計(jì)與應(yīng)用 電子工業(yè)出版社 [7]馬義玲,汪令江,曾勇 數(shù)據(jù)庫(kù)應(yīng)用 FoxPro for windows 機(jī)械工業(yè)出版社 en, until in the Deeps of Time and in the midst of the vast halls of E?there came to be that hour and that place where was made the habitation of the Children of I l 鷙 atar. And in this wor k the chief part was taken by Manw ?and Aul?andthe Valar fortified their dwelling, and upon the shores of the sea they raised the Pel 髍 i, the Mountains of Aman, highest upon Earth. A nd above all the mountains of the Pel 髍 i was that height upon whose summit Manw ?set his throne. Taniquetil the E lves name that holy mountain, and O ioloss?Everlasting Whiteness, and Elerr 韓 a Crowned with Stars, and many names beside。 but the Sind